Downloaded today the Kanotix Spitfire 2016 LXDE 64 bit iso and did a frugal install.
Have to say : nice piece of work. Thank you very much!
Only one small problem : '.config/openbox/lxde-rc.xml' doesn't do not its job. The superkey in combination with a letter shows a small rectangle in the upper right corner of the screen with that letter inside instead of starting a program. (eg : "W-f" for starting PCManFM)
Had a look : the windows key (superkey) under 'xev' gives : keycode 133 (keysym 0xffeb, Super_L) which is OK, I think.
Any help?

| This is working for me, but keep in mind that the openbox key konfiguration doesn't work if compiz is enabled. |

mzee wrote:
If you allow me : how to disable Compiz in Kanotix.
In the Taskbar you will find the Compiz-Fusion Tray Icon, right click, select Window-Manager, try openbox-lxde or compiz. |
